Product Overview

The 1769-L18ER-BB1B is a high-performance, compact programmable automation controller (PAC) from the Allen-Bradley CompactLogix 5370 L1 series. Engineered for small to mid-range applications, this controller integrates high-density embedded I/O with advanced networking capabilities in a space-saving form factor. It is uniquely designed to use 1734 POINT I/O modules as its local expansion bus, providing unparalleled flexibility in cabinet layouts. With dual EtherNet/IP ports supporting Device Level Ring (DLR) and integrated motion for up to 2 CIP Motion axes, the 1769-L18ER-BB1B serves as an authoritative solution for coordinated machine control and distributed intelligence.

Detailed Technical Specifications

Attribute Details
Manufacturer Allen-Bradley / Rockwell Automation
Model Number 1769-L18ER-BB1B
Product Family CompactLogix 5370 L1
User Memory 512 KB (0.5 MB)
Non-Volatile Memory 1 GB SD Card included (supports up to 2 GB)
Embedded Digital I/O 16 DC Inputs (24V DC), 16 DC Outputs (24V DC)
Integrated Motion Supports up to 2 axes of CIP Motion on EtherNet/IP
EtherNet/IP Nodes Supports up to 8 nodes
Communication Ports (2) EtherNet/IP Ports, (1) USB 1.1 Port
Network Topologies Linear, Star, and Device Level Ring (DLR)
Expansion Bus Supports up to 8 local 1734 POINT I/O modules
Programming Languages Relay Ladder, Structured Text, Function Block, SFC
Power Supply 24V DC Input
Operating Temperature 0 °C to +60 °C (32 °F to +140 °F)
Weight 1.38 lbs (0.62 kg)
